Health Mart Vincent - Hours & Locations
Health Mart - Birmingham
1032 South 20th Street, Birmingham AL 35205 Phone Number:(205) 251-4248Hours may fluctuate
Distance:23.67 miles
Health Mart - Homewood
940 Oxmoor Road, Homewood AL 35209 Phone Number:(205) 871-9000Hours may fluctuate
Distance:23.74 miles
Health Mart - Birmingham
521 South 21st Street, Birmingham AL 35233 Phone Number:(205) 323-2474Hours may fluctuate
Distance:24.22 miles
Health Mart - Pinson
6767 Old Springville Road, Pinson AL 35126 Phone Number:(205) 680-5557Hours may fluctuate
Distance:24.54 miles
Health Mart - Tarrant
1152 East Lake Blvd., Tarrant AL 35217 Phone Number:(205) 841-6421Hours may fluctuate
Distance:24.90 miles
Health Mart - Birmingham
1513 5th Avenue N, Birmingham AL 35203 Phone Number:(205) 323-8374Hours may fluctuate
Distance:24.98 miles
Health Mart - Tarrant
541 Jackson Blvd, Tarrant AL 35217 Phone Number:(205) 841-6432Hours may fluctuate
Distance:25.09 miles
Health Mart - Hoover
758 Shades Mountain Plaza, Hoover AL 35226 Phone Number:(205) 823-9500Hours may fluctuate
Distance:25.20 miles
Health Mart - Birmingham
633 Tuscaloosa Avenue, Birmingham AL 35211 Phone Number:(205) 785-3159Hours may fluctuate
Distance:26.17 miles
Health Mart - Alabaster
205 Buck Creek Plaza, Alabaster AL 35007 Phone Number:(205) 664-1200Hours may fluctuate
Distance:26.55 miles